Today’s guest is author K.L. Walther!

K.L. Walther is the #1 New York Times and USA Today bestselling author of The Summer of Broken Rules, While We’re Young, and A First Time for Everything among others. Born and raised in the rolling hills of Bucks County, Pennsylvania, she is happiest when reading a romance on the beach or bantering with her better half while waiting in line for ice cream. She currently lives in Philadelphia with her husband and golden retriever. 

In this episode we discussed her most recent release, WE’RE A BAD IDEA, RIGHT?, which published just a few days ago, which is inspired by the 80’s classic Risky Business. Our conversation took us to glass blowing, and Airb&b’s and ventured into publishing topics like her upcoming 2 book per year schedule, our appreciation for Stephanie Perkins, and how she writes long drafts.
